The page makes a modest adjustment visible because menopause and ageing can coincide with changes in body composition, activity, sleep, and energy expenditure. The percentage is an educational scenario, not a universal physiological constant and not a way to determine whether someone is peri- or post-menopausal. The 2023 PubMed review describes menopause-related metabolic change as complex and requiring patient-centred, multidisciplinary care; it does not prescribe a universal three-percent correction. Use this factor as a transparent sensitivity case and calibrate with weight trends, measured intake, activity, and clinical advice. Menopause BMR formula and assumptions

Base Mifflin-St Jeor BMR × 0.97; estimated TDEE = adjusted BMR × activity multiplier

If a base BMR is 1,450 kcal/day, the illustrative 3% adjustment is 43.5 kcal and the adjusted estimate is 1,406.5 kcal/day before activity is applied. The worked example is a reasonableness check, not a target or an expected result for every person. Recalculate with your own inputs and keep full precision until the displayed rounding step.
